Latest news

Mit SimpleXMLElement CDATA und Comment Sections erzeugen

Vor ein paar Tagen stellte sich mir bzw. stellte ich mir die Frage, wie man mit SimpleXMLElement CDATA und Comment Sections erzeugen kann. Kurz und gut, hier ist das Ergebnis in Form einer Klasse: * @access public */ class XmlSimple { /** * creates new SimpleXML object with named root node * @param string $sRoot … Weiterlesen

PHP EXE Compiler/Embedder (php2exe)

Da hat man ein cooles PHP-Script geschrieben und möchte das aus gutem Grund anderen Leuten zukommen lassen. Allerdings weiss man selber nicht, ob sein Gegenüber PHP installiert hat oder in der Lage ist, PHP überhaupt zu installieren. Warum dann nicht mit dem Bambalam PHP EXE Compiler/Embedder als EXE auliefern? Allein schon seine Compiler-Optionen sprechen für … Weiterlesen

Dynamischer Auto Port HTTP Webserver unter C#

Dass man in .NET C# auch multithreaded HTTP Webserver schreiben kann, dürfte jedem klar sein. Hier mal ein Klassenbeispiel, das automatisch einen freien Port ermittelt und den NAN_Webserver als Instant Webserver startet. Wahlweise können PHP, Perl, etc als CGI-ausführende Programme deaklariert werden samt Dateitypen, sowie das Home-Verzeiichnis, und zwar alles direkt aus dem GUI-Designer heraus. … Weiterlesen

PDF-Dateien unter Beibehaltung des Layouts in HTML umwandeln

PDF-Dateien unter Beibehaltung des Layouts in HTML umwandeln

Einschließlich der Technik Geschützte PDF-Dateien wieder zugänglich machen, wobei die bereinigten Dateien im HTML-Ausgabeverzeichnis liegen 😉 , ist die neue Version meines PDF2HTML MegaPack erschienen, das PDF Dateien in HTML konvertiert, wahlweise als Framest mit Seitennavigation oder einer einzigen Seite. Optional kann der Vergrößerungsfaktor (Zoom) geändert werden. PDF2HTML MegaPack Downloads: 30025 times Erstveröffentlichung am 16.03.2023 … Weiterlesen

Enthält Super 2007 Schadprogramme?

Jetzt habe ich so großartig in meinem Artikel SWF-Dateien in AVI, FLV und viele andere Video-Formate umwandeln über den Video-Transcoder Super 2007 als positives Beispiel berichtet und dann sowas. Ich aktualisiere Super 2007, weil eine neue Version online ist, nämlich die Version v2007.build.23. Nach der Installation lasse ich eine meiner Dateien in FLV verwandeln und … Weiterlesen

sourceforge.net: API ähnlich aktuelle Datei-Download-URLs ermitteln

An dieser Stelle nur ein kleines Beispiel, wie man mit PHP von sourceforge.net API ähnlich die Download URL zu einer Datei-Version eines Spiegel-Servers ermittelt mit Hilfe meiner sourceforge.net SF.net Klasse, die die Snoopy-Klasse erweitert, welche einen Web-Browser simuliert. Hier die Klasse: < ?php /** @see http://snoopy.sourceforge.net/ / require_once (dirname(FILE) . DIRECTORY_SEPARATOR . ‘Snoopy.class.php’); /** small … Weiterlesen

Sicherheitslücke: yigg.de relativ einfach betrügbar

Wenn man die Verbindung zum Provider trennt, nach erneuter Verbindung mit dem Provider eine IP-Adrese zugewiesen bekommt, im Firefox "Pivate Daten löschen" anklickt und die Seite neu lädt (am besten jeweils die eigene Seite mit integiertem Yigg-Button), dann kann man sofort erneut (auch und insbesondere für sich) stimmen. Erstveröffentlichung am 16.03.2023 @ 13:58

SoapRpcService.php – WSDL für SOAP RPC made easy

Dass man mit Entwicklungs-Umgebungen wie z.B. auch SharpDevelop (rechte Mautaste im Projekt -> "Web Referenz hinzufügen") über automatisiert erstellte Proxies sehr einfach auf SOAP RPC zugreifen kann, werden die meisten ja wissen. Wer PHP-Dienste via NuSOAP anbietet, dem ist bestimmt auch schon aufgefallen, dass es ziemlich umständlich ist, wenn es darum geht, eigene Datentypen/Datenstrukturen zu … Weiterlesen

PHP5/PHP6 Funktionen, Konstanten, Variablen unter PHP4 nutzen

Wie oft ärgert man sich, wenn man auf den PHP Anleitungsseiten wieder einmal eine Funktion findet, die man gut gebrauchen könnte, diese aber nur für eine höhere PHP-Version verfügbar ist. Wer dieses Problem kennt, hat anscheinend noch nichts von PHP_Compat aus dem PEAR Projekt gehört. Wer PEAR nicht magt und darum auch nicht nutzt, kann … Weiterlesen

Geschützte PDF-Dateien wieder zugänglich machen.

Es gibt einige PDF-Dateien, die sind selbst gegen Drucken geschützt Man kann diese Dateien allerdings umspeichern, so dass man diese wieder drucken kann. Einfach Ghostscript installieren und über die Kommandozeile wie folgt Ghostscript aufrufen (Window Beispiel) : -dSAFER -dBATCH -dNOPAUSE -sDEVICE=”pdfwrite” -sFONTPATH=”C:\WINDOWS\fonts;xfonts” -sPDFPassword= -dPDFSETTINGS=”/prepress” -dPassThroughJPEGImages=”true” -sOutputFile=”” “” Mal schauen, ob Eure Auge genauso leuchten, wenn … Weiterlesen